Antonio Ledezma, former metropolitan mayor of Caracas, points out that "there are no free elections in a country where state institutions are controlled by a dictatorship," referring to the regional elections held on Sunday in Venezuela.
The United Socialist Party of Venezuela (PSUV) won 20 of the 23 governorships and the mayor of Libertador Municipality, which includes part of Caracas, announced on Monday the president of the Electoral Council of Venezuela (CNE), Pedro Calzadilla.
